National Parents Day Off, celebrated on September 14th, is like a fun break for parents. On this day, kids try to give their parents a rest from their usual chores or responsibilities. It's a time when children might help with small tasks or show appreciation by making art and crafts. The idea is to let parents relax and feel appreciated for all the hard work they do every day. It's similar to Mother's Day or Father's Day, but this time, it's about both parents taking a little time for themselves while families enjoy happy moments together.
How to celebrate National Parents Day Off?
On National Parents Day Off, you can make breakfast for your parents, like toast and eggs. You can make them a special card to show your love. Plan a fun day for them, maybe by picking a movie for them to watch. You could also offer to do some chores, like cleaning your room or washing dishes, to give them a break. Invite them for a family walk or play their favorite board game together. At the end of the day, you can all sit together and have a yummy dinner, letting them relax and enjoy their special day.
